I'm speculating here but the error that seems to be blowing it up is this:
> Object reference not set to an instance of an object at
System.TimeZoneInfo.IsInvalidTime
> at System.TimeZoneInfo.IsDaylightSavingTime (DateTime dateTime)
[0x00000] in <filename unknown>:0
Googling that up there seem to be some issues with some timezones on Mono,
like this bug:
https://bugzilla.novell.com/show_bug.cgi?id=619811
If that's it, you can probably fix it either by upgrading Mono, but first
it might be worth tinkering around with your system timezone to see if that
helps - for example, if you're currently set to a timezone that doesn't use
daylight savings time, try setting to one that does, or if you're at a
timezone that does, try setting to one that doesn't.
